What are mail surveys?

Mail surveys are questionnaires sent to predetermined demographic samples via the postal service. The targeted respondents are asked to fill out the questionnaires and mail them back. Reminder cards and/or letters are frequently used in mail surveys to boost response rates. The relative affordability of mail surveys for businesses is a benefit.

Additional benefits include having low administrative expenditures and having a wide geographic reach. The reliance on respondents speaking the language of the questionnaire and possessing a sufficient level of literacy for research participation makes mail survey approaches disadvantageous. Additionally, the return of questionnaires is dependent on responders, and even more significantly, it is impossible to verify that the target population is the one who responds.

The practice of altering the context of a story to affect perception is known as _____.
framing
priming
slant
filtering

Answers

Option (a), "framing." Framing refers to the practice of altering the context or presentation of a story or information to affect how it is perceived by an audience.

Framing involves presenting information in a particular way to influence how people understand and interpret it. This can involve highlighting certain aspects of a story or emphasizing certain details to make it more salient or memorable. Framing can also involve using language or imagery that conveys a particular message or tone, such as using emotionally charged words to evoke a certain response from the audience. Overall, framing is a powerful tool for shaping public opinion and influencing decision-making, and it is used extensively in politics, media, advertising, and other fields.

The ______ is a memory aid in which a person creates images of to-be-remembered information and pairs them with locations along a familiar route or place.

Answers

Answer:

The appropriate answer is "Method of loci".

Explanation:

A memory improvement approach that employs visualizations of recognizable spatial contexts to improve knowledge retrieval, is termed as "Method of loci".Throughout the certain sequence, relevant knowledge could be remembered by following this very similar route mostly on the imaginative excursion. The individual combines objects with points of interest in certain recognizable spots to remind them of events going.

An open-pit mine must fund an account now to pay for maintenance of a tailing pond in perpetuity (after the mine shuts down in 30 years). The costs until shutdown are part of the mine's operating costs. The maintenance costs begin in 31st year at $300,000 annually. (a) How much must be deposited now if the fund will earn 5% interest? How much does this change if the interest rate is 4% ? (b) What is a tailing pond? Is the mine building this because they are a good corporate citizen or because they are required to do so? By whom? Could it be both

Answers

The amount that must be deposited now to pay for maintenance costs in perpetuity is $6,000,000 and If the interest rate is reduced to 4%, the amount that must be deposited now to pay for maintenance costs in perpetuity will increase to $7,500,000.

To calculate the amount that must be deposited now to pay for maintenance costs in perpetuity, we need to calculate the present value of the perpetuity. This can be done using the formula:

Present Value = Annual Maintenance Cost / Discount Rate

Where the discount rate is the interest rate at which the fund will earn.

At 5% interest rate:

Present Value = $300,000 / 0.05

Present Value = $6,000,000

Therefore, the amount that must be deposited now to pay for maintenance costs in perpetuity is $6,000,000.

At 4% interest rate:

Present Value = $300,000 / 0.04

Present Value = $7,500,000

Therefore, if the interest rate is reduced to 4%, the amount that must be deposited now to pay for maintenance costs in perpetuity will increase to $7,500,000.

the spreading activation model proposes that people organize general knowledge based on ____.

Answers

The spreading activation model proposes that people organize general knowledge based on networks of associations or interconnected concepts and that each concept is connected to another through links called associative links. Hence, the main answer to the given question is networks of associations or interconnected concepts.

The spreading activation model is a method of modelling how people organize their general knowledge, and it proposes that the organization is done based on networks of associations or interconnected concepts. This model is based on the concept of semantic memory, which is the memory of general knowledge about the world we live in. It suggests that each concept is connected to another through links called associative links.

For example, if someone asks you about a cat, the word "cat" activates a network of associations that include things like "furry," "four-legged," "pet," "animal," and "meows." Each of these concepts, in turn, is connected to other concepts through associative links, such as "furry" being linked to "soft," "four-legged" being linked to "dog," and so on. As you retrieve information from memory, it activates related concepts, which in turn activate other concepts. This process is called spreading activation, and it is the basis of how people organize and retrieve their general knowledge.
